当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

分布式对象存储有哪些,深入解析分布式对象存储系统,原理、架构与优势

分布式对象存储有哪些,深入解析分布式对象存储系统,原理、架构与优势

分布式对象存储系统包括如Ceph、GlusterFS、HDFS等。深入解析其原理,涉及数据分片、复制和一致性算法。架构上,通常采用主从结构,保障高可用和可扩展性。优势在...

分布式对象存储系统包括如Ceph、GlusterFS、HDFS等。深入解析其原理,涉及数据分片、复制和一致性算法。架构上,通常采用主从结构,保障高可用和可扩展性。优势在于高吞吐量、高可用性以及良好的横向扩展能力。

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足日益增长的数据存储需求,分布式对象存储系统作为一种新型的存储技术,以其高可用性、高性能、高扩展性等特点,逐渐成为大数据时代的主流存储方式,本文将深入解析分布式对象存储系统的原理、架构与优势,以帮助读者更好地理解这一技术。

分布式对象存储系统概述

1、定义

分布式对象存储系统(Distributed Object Storage System,DOS)是一种基于分布式存储架构,以对象为单位进行存储和管理的系统,它将存储资源分布在多个节点上,通过网络连接实现数据的分布式存储和访问。

分布式对象存储有哪些,深入解析分布式对象存储系统,原理、架构与优势

2、特点

(1)高可用性:分布式对象存储系统采用冗余存储机制,即使某个节点发生故障,也不会影响系统的正常运行。

(2)高性能:通过并行处理和负载均衡,分布式对象存储系统可以实现高并发、高吞吐量的数据访问。

(3)高扩展性:分布式对象存储系统可以根据需求动态调整存储资源,满足不断增长的数据存储需求。

(4)安全性:分布式对象存储系统采用数据加密、访问控制等安全机制,保障数据安全。

分布式对象存储系统架构

1、存储节点

存储节点是分布式对象存储系统的基本单元,负责存储数据,每个节点包含存储设备和相应的软件,如文件系统、元数据管理等。

2、数据存储层

数据存储层是分布式对象存储系统的核心部分,负责数据的存储、检索和更新,它通常采用分布式文件系统(如HDFS、Ceph等)来实现。

分布式对象存储有哪些,深入解析分布式对象存储系统,原理、架构与优势

3、元数据管理

元数据管理负责存储和管理对象元数据,如对象ID、对象大小、创建时间等,元数据管理采用分布式数据库(如Redis、Zookeeper等)来实现。

4、存储网络

存储网络负责连接各个存储节点,实现数据传输,它通常采用高速以太网、InfiniBand等高速网络技术。

5、控制节点

控制节点负责管理分布式对象存储系统,包括数据分配、负载均衡、故障恢复等,控制节点通常采用分布式协调框架(如Paxos、Raft等)来实现。

分布式对象存储系统优势

1、节能环保

分布式对象存储系统采用分布式存储架构,可以有效降低数据中心能耗,实现节能环保。

2、降低成本

分布式对象存储有哪些,深入解析分布式对象存储系统,原理、架构与优势

分布式对象存储系统通过提高存储资源利用率,降低存储成本,其高可用性、高扩展性等特点,可减少硬件投资。

3、提高效率

分布式对象存储系统采用并行处理、负载均衡等技术,可提高数据访问效率,满足高并发需求。

4、数据安全保障

分布式对象存储系统采用数据加密、访问控制等安全机制,保障数据安全。

分布式对象存储系统作为一种新型的存储技术,在当今大数据时代具有广泛的应用前景,通过对分布式对象存储系统的原理、架构与优势进行深入解析,有助于读者更好地理解这一技术,为实际应用提供参考,随着技术的不断发展,分布式对象存储系统将在未来发挥更加重要的作用。

黑狐家游戏

发表评论

最新文章